About OCTAVE SPECIALTY GROUP INC
Octave Specialty Group, Inc. functions as a financial services holding company, organizing its operations into two distinct divisions. Its Specialty Property and Casualty Insurance segment delivers specialized program insurance, primarily focusing on coverage for commercial and personal liability exposures. The second division, Insurance Distribution, offers a broad spectrum of services for distributing specialty property and casualty insurance, which includes roles such as managing general agents, underwriters, and insurance brokers, alongside other related distribution and underwriting ventures. Established in 1971, the company, with its corporate headquarters located in New York, New York, rebranded from its former name, Ambac Financial Group, Inc., to Octave Specialty Group, Inc. in November 2025.
